Whispers of the Past: A Love Unraveled
In the bustling heart of London, amidst the clatter of cobblestones and the scent of horse-drawn carriages, a whisper of the past stirred the air. It was a whisper that would change the lives of those who heard it, a whisper that reached across the chasm of time.
Amelia, a woman of the modern age, found herself standing in the rain, her mind racing as she clutched her ancient pocket watch. It was a relic she had inherited from her great-grandmother, a watch that had always seemed to possess a life of its own. Now, as the rain soaked through her coat, she realized that her life was about to change in ways she could never have imagined.
A flash of light, a blur of motion, and Amelia was no longer in the present. She was in the Victorian era, amidst the opulence of a grand ballroom. The air was thick with the scent of lilies and the sound of a grand waltz. She was surrounded by people dressed in period attire, their eyes wide with curiosity as they gazed upon the intruder.
Amelia's heart pounded as she tried to process her surroundings. She had always been a fan of historical fiction, but this was no mere daydream. She was now a part of this world, a world where time was a tapestry woven with threads of the past and future.
She was approached by a young man, Lord Edward, whose eyes held a spark that seemed to ignite her own. "Who are you?" he demanded, his voice tinged with both anger and curiosity.
"I am... Amelia," she stammered, her voice barely above a whisper. "I... I came from the future."
Edward's brow furrowed in confusion, but his eyes softened as he looked at her. "The future? How is that possible?"
Amelia took a deep breath, determined to tell him her story. She explained about the pocket watch, about her great-grandmother, and how she had always felt a strange connection to this era. As she spoke, Edward listened intently, his curiosity piqued.
But Amelia's arrival was not just a coincidence. She had been drawn to this time by a love story that had unfolded centuries before. Lord Edward had been betrothed to a woman named Isabella, a love that had been as strong as the iron chains that bound them. Amelia's great-grandmother had been Isabella's closest confidante, and through her, Amelia had learned of the tragic love story that had unfolded.
As Amelia delved deeper into the lives of Edward and Isabella, she discovered that their love had been tested by time and fate. Isabella had been falsely accused of a crime, and Edward, in his grief and anger, had vowed to end her life. It was a vow that had been sealed by the very chains that had bound them.
Amelia's heart ached for Isabella, whose eyes had held a pain that seemed to reach across the centuries. She knew that she had to help Isabella, to prevent the tragedy that had been foretold. But how could she, a woman from the future, alter the course of history?
As Amelia navigated the complexities of the Victorian era, she found herself drawn to Edward, whose own heart was torn between duty and love. The two of them formed an unlikely alliance, with Amelia determined to save Isabella and Edward from the tragic fate that awaited them.
But as the days passed, Amelia realized that her own heart was entangled in this love story. She found herself torn between her loyalty to Isabella and her growing affection for Edward. The lines between past and present blurred, and Amelia was forced to make a decision that would alter the course of history.
In a heart-wrenching climax, Amelia confronted Edward, revealing the truth about Isabella and the crime she had been falsely accused of. As Edward's eyes filled with sorrow and understanding, Amelia knew that she had to step back, to allow their love to unfold as it was meant to.
With a heavy heart, Amelia returned to her own time, leaving Edward and Isabella to their fate. But as she closed her eyes and the flash of light enveloped her, she couldn't help but wonder if her actions had truly saved them or if their love would have been stronger without her interference.
In the end, Amelia realized that time was a delicate tapestry, one that could not be altered without consequence. Her journey through the Victorian era had taught her that love, no matter the era, was a force that could overcome even the deepest chasms of time.
As she opened her eyes in her own time, Amelia knew that she would always carry the whispers of the past with her. The love story of Edward and Isabella had become a part of her own, a reminder that even in the face of time, love could endure.
